Jace: I didn't kiss her. That was the first thing I told myself. As if not doing something somehow meant it hadn't almost happened. I drove Calla home with both hands on the steering wheel and my eyes firmly on the road. Mostly. She sat beside me in my flannel, hair still damp from the river, her bare feet tucked beneath her. The radio played quietly. Neither of us said much. Which was probably a good thing. Because every time I looked at her, I remembered the bridge. Her hand in mine. The way she'd looked at me before I leaned in. The way she hadn't moved away. I rubbed my hand over my chest. Calla noticed. "You okay?" "Yeah." "You're doing that thing." "What thing?"
